Outstanding features: Excellent features for project-related time tracking

Key integrations: Basecamp, Insightly, QuickBooks, Trello, Xero

Pricing structure: Avaza is free for a single user who can edit timesheets, five invoices per month, five active projects, ten clients (guest accounts), and unlimited project collaborators. Businesses can upgrade to two users, 20 active projects, and unlimited clients for $9.95/month. $19.95 gets you five users and 50 active projects, and $39.95 gets you ten users and unlimited projects.

It's worth noting that rather than imitating Trello's pricing (a fixed price per user per month) like other products on this list, Avaza's feature set grows with the monthly price. For example, the base price per user in the most expensive package ($39.95 per month) is actually just $3.95 per user per month, making the tool surprisingly affordable.

Despite all this, ClickUp is still a relatively young product: it was only released in 2017.

For the features it shares with Trello, it offers a fairly straightforward alternative—and even with some improvements. For example, users can filter and comment on cards, tag them, view them in threads, and mark them as solved, just like Trello. You can also use rich text, view real-time collaboration (similar to Google Wave , which was ahead of its time), and switch between board views.

ClickUp's handling of account permissions is also unique. Administrators can assign permissions based on the project hierarchy - at the organization, team, project or task level.

For the remaining features, ClickUp relies heavily on integrations, such as Dropbox for file sharing, Google Calendar for calendar viewing, and Harvest for time tracking. To make up for these missing features, ClickUp offers some AI features in beta, including deadline prediction, resource management, and task effort.
